model: Move IFilterableDataModel in IElementResolver
Deprecates IFilterableDataModel and move its content to
IElementResolver.
These 2 classes serve similar purposes: allow various elements to
provide data on which to search and filter. One is a multimap to allow
an element to have multiple values for a single key, while the other did
not allow that. Only multimap remains now. The map method is deprecated.
The filters have been updated to supported multimap as inputs.
